Group Policy define exceptions for cookies and site data

In our organization, we enforce through group policy to clear cookies and site data each time the browser is closed. I see there's an exception list to define certain sites that it will not clear cookies or site data. Where in group policy can this exception be set.

This option can be seen (allow) from the article here under Block cookies and site data for more than one website > Step 3 https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/kb/block-websites-storing-cookies-site-data-firefox

Can I set Multi Account Containers default containers with endpoint deployment?

I am installing Firefox via microsoft endpoint, and deploying multi account containers with the OMA-URI policy for extensions. (this blog page is super helpful! https://securitygeneralist.blogspot.com/2019/08/auto-installing-extensions-on-firefox.html )

The extension by default has containers for Personal, Work, Banking, Shopping.

Is there a way to automatically remove that default container list as part of the install?

Even better, is there a way to create a different default containers list through Endpoint?
